On 3/31/26 20:08, Sechang Lim wrote:
> commit 605f6586ecf7 ("mm/vma: do not leak memory when .mmap_prepare
> swaps the file") handled the success path by skipping get_file() via
> file_doesnt_need_get, but missed the error path.
>
> When /dev/zero is mmap'd with MAP_SHARED, mmap_zero_prepare() calls
> shmem_zero_setup_desc() which allocates a new shmem file to back the
> mapping. If __mmap_new_vma() subsequently fails, this replacement
> file is never fput()'d - the original is released by
> ksys_mmap_pgoff(), but nobody releases the new one.
>
> Add fput() for the swapped file in the error path.
>
> Reproducible with fault injection.
